A comprehensive, direct and no holds barred guide to sex, dating and relationships after divorce. Combining the lessons learned and insights garnered from his own post divorce journey with his guiding relationship work with many couples, this book gives extensive and practical tips, suggestions and even relationship commandments to help you find a great life partner in less time with less frustration and difficulty.
